How To Use Movavi Screen Recorder
The principle behind the software is really simple. You use it in order to record everything that you see or hear on your screen. This does include audio content from all websites or apps. You can even record the audio you hear in video games or in movies.
In order to use Movavi Screen Recorder you just need to download it and run it. Then, you have to choose recording parameters. In this case you only want to record the audio that the computer registers. Select that, play the track you want on Spotify or any desired website and record it. Then, you can choose what format to save it in. MP3 is the preferred format since it can be used on literally any device you might want to.
Is It Legal To Record Audio?
This is highly debatable and the truth is that it is not easy to answer with a simple yes or no. If you have a paid Spotify account, there won’t really be a problem. Also, in the event that you record the audio of something that you have the license to or for a business meeting that you held, legality does not come into question. However, based on what country you live in, there might be some legal aspects you have to be aware of.
